Solve the equation
-10x+1+7x=37
a. x=-15
b. x=-12
c. x=12
d. x=15

You can solve this algebraically

-10x + 1 + 7x = 37

Combine like terms

-3x + 1 = 37

Subtract 1 from both sides

-3x = 36

Divide both sides by -3

x = -12

The answer is B) x = -12
